  • Hesketh Park Lodge, Southport
Located beside its picturesque namesake, Hesketh Park Lodge provides a warm, welcoming environment offering specialist dementia and nursing care.

The lodge supports long-term stays as well as respite care, including rehabilitation for those transitioning from hospital to home. With 79 thoughtfully designed bedrooms, residents benefit from personalised, high-quality care in a close-knit community focused on comfort, mobility and wellbeing.

Residents enjoy modern facilities throughout the lodge, including comfortable lounges, a health and beauty salon, and a cinema room. Each bedroom is well equipped with an adjustable profiling bed, ensuite wet room, call bell system and TV. Family and friends are always welcome.

Nutritious, home-cooked meals are prepared daily onsite, with menus tailored to individual tastes and dietary needs. A dedicated Lifestyle and Wellbeing team also provides a varied programme of daily activities, creating a vibrant, engaging, and enjoyable place to live.

Support you may be entitled to

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

Review from S L (Friend of Resident) published on 30 October 2024 Submitted via Postal Card • Report
Overall Experience 4.0 out of 5
I looked at 22 care homes before deciding on Hesketh Park Lodge. My friend could propel herself in her wheelchair. Hesketh Park Lodge was excellent for this with smooth flooring, so hygienic! Her room was lovely as it overlooked the park, which she loved going in. In the beginning, she was encouraged
to bring her own possessions with her which she thought was wonderful, it made it feel like home. Towards the end the nurses looked after her leg ulcers and they said she was always happy and smiling even if it was painful. The staff enjoyed looking after her, nothing was too much trouble for them. She was always thanking them for what they did for her. The 3 years my friend was in there I never heard her complain, so I feel that after looking at 22 homes I did pick the right one and would actually recommend it to anyone.

Overview of Review Score

The Review Score of 9.7 (9.670) out of 10 for Hesketh Park Lodge is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  1. The Average Rating is 4.7 out of 5 from 32 Reviews in the last 24 months.
  2. The score for the number of positive Reviews is 5.0 out of 5 from 31 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.670 for Hesketh Park Lodge is calculated as follows: ( (261 Excellents x 5) + (102 Goods x 4) + (9 Satisfactorys x 3) + (1 Poors x 2) ) ÷ 373 Ratings = 4.67
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5'). The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Hesketh Park Lodge is based on 31 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    1. 4 points are available for the first 20 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ews, 0.05 Points for the next five Positive Reviews, and finally 0.025 Points for the next ten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.050, 7th = 0.050, 8th = 0.050, 9th = 0.050, 10th = 0.050, 11th = 0.025, 12th = 0.025, 13th = 0.025, 14th = 0.025, 15th = 0.025, 16th = 0.025, 17th = 0.025, 18th = 0.025, 19th = 0.025, 20th = 0.025)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.05 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 + 0.025 = 4
    2. 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 79 registered maximum number of service users is 15.8, which has been reached with 31 Positive reviews. Points = 1
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
